Trauma Recovery: Therapist Support for Long-Term Recovery
Trauma can have a profound and lasting impact on an individual’s mental health. Therapist support for trauma recovery focuses on understanding the deep-seated emotions and experiences that contribute to traumatic stress. By employing techniques such as cognitive-behavioral therapy and EMDR, therapists help individuals process these experiences in a safe environment, promoting healing and facilitating a path to long-term recovery.

Sleep Disorder Treatment: From Exhaustion to Energy
Sleep disorders can lead to significant physical and mental health issues. Treatment for these disorders involves a combination of medical and therapeutic approaches to restore healthy sleep patterns. Therapists often use techniques such as cognitive-behavioral therapy for insomnia (CBT-I) to help individuals modify the thoughts and behaviors that disrupt sleep, transitioning from exhaustion to energy.

OCD Support: Reducing Intrusive Thoughts
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D) is characterized by unwanted and intrusive thoughts that lead to compulsive behaviors. OCD support through therapy focuses on reducing these intrusive thoughts and the associated compulsions. Techniques such as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P) are commonly used to help individuals confront their fears and reduce the power of obsessive thoughts over time.

What should I expect during a first visit to a psychiatrist in Broadview Mobile Home Park?
During your first visit, the psychiatrist will typically conduct a comprehensive assessment that may include discussing your medical and mental health history, current symptoms, and any medications you are taking. This initial consultation aims to formulate a proper diagnosis and develop a treatment plan tailored to your needs.
